Kazakhstan: Population ages 65 and above, male

In , Kazakhstan's Population ages 65 and above, male was 650,683.00.

That's up 6.6% from 2023, the highest value on record.

The global average for this indicator in 2024 was 1,692,267.74 . Kazakhstan ranks #60 globally out of 217 reporting countries. Within Europe & Central Asia, it ranks #21 of 58.

Source: World Bank Open Data (SP.POP.65UP.MA.IN) • Data as of 2024

About Population ages 65 and above, male

Male population 65 years of age or older. Population is based on the de facto definition of population, which counts all residents regardless of legal status or citizenship.
